Crazy thing happened yesterday in Toronto. A small Piper airplane took off from a small airport and had just had a total inspection. Took off and got to 2000 feet and the guy switched tanks to keep it balanced. The motor started to fail and the guy had to land as he wouldn't make it back to the airport. So he landed it on the 407 Toll Highway and did a fabulous job said the Cop a pilot himself.
Good job it was the Toll Road because it wasn't busy.
They called in a float and loaded the plane on the float sideways and had a police escort of course. Something you don't see everyday. I'm sure the mechanic that passed the plane's inspection will be asked a few questions lol
